When storms hit Willoughby Hills, what we find depends partly on housing age. Most homes here date from 1950s through the 2000s, and older roofs respond to wind, hail, and ice differently than newer ones.
Willoughby Hills' wooded character and larger lots create ongoing gutter loading and ice dam concerns on shaded eaves — gutter guards and heavier ice-and-water shield are routine specs here.
The mix of mid-century to newer custom homes means tear-off patterns vary widely from property to property.
Often you can't tell from the ground. We provide free inspections that include close-up photos of any hail strikes. Look for dents in your gutters or AC fins as a clue — if those have damage, your roof likely does too.
Often yes, if the damage is widespread (typically 8+ strikes per 100 sq ft per insurance industry standards). If qualifies, your insurance pays for the full replacement minus your deductible.
Most policies require claims within 1 year of the event. The sooner the better — fresh damage is easier to document and date.
